The Role of Edge Computing in Cloud Hosting

Edge computing is emerging as a critical component of cloud hosting strategies, particularly as the demand for low-latency processing grows. You may be aware that edge computing involves processing data closer to its source rather than relying solely on centralized cloud servers. This approach significantly reduces latency and improves response times, which is essential for applications requiring real-time data processing.

As you explore edge computing’s role in cloud hosting, consider how it complements traditional cloud services. By distributing computing resources closer to users or devices, edge computing alleviates some of the burdens on central servers while enhancing overall performance. This hybrid model allows you to enjoy the benefits of both centralized and decentralized computing, ensuring that your applications run smoothly even under heavy loads or during peak usage times.

Security and Privacy Measures in Cloud Hosting

As you navigate the world of cloud hosting, security and privacy are paramount concerns that cannot be overlooked. With increasing cyber threats and data breaches making headlines regularly, it’s essential to understand how cloud providers safeguard your information. Most reputable cloud hosting services implement robust security measures such as encryption, multi-factor authentication, and regular security audits to protect your data from unauthorized access.

Additionally, compliance with regulations such as GDPR or HIPAA is crucial for businesses operating in sensitive sectors. You should ensure that your chosen cloud provider adheres to these regulations to maintain the integrity and confidentiality of your data. By prioritizing security and privacy measures in your cloud strategy, you can mitigate risks while enjoying the benefits of cloud technology.

Future Trends and Innovations in Cloud Hosting

Looking ahead, the future of cloud hosting is brimming with potential innovations that could reshape how you interact with technology. One trend gaining traction is serverless computing, which allows developers to build applications without managing server infrastructure directly. This approach not only simplifies development but also optimizes resource usage by automatically scaling based on demand.

Another exciting development is the rise of hybrid and multi-cloud strategies. As organizations seek greater flexibility and resilience, many are adopting a combination of public and private clouds tailored to their specific needs. This trend enables you to leverage the strengths of different cloud environments while minimizing risks associated with vendor lock-in.

What is cloud hosting?

Cloud hosting is a type of web hosting service that utilizes multiple virtual servers to host websites and applications. It allows for scalability, flexibility, and reliability by using resources from a network of physical servers.
